BOX 1202 LARAMIE, WY 82070 Be advised that I, Ron Broda, Weld County Pest Inspector hereby give you notice in accordance with Section 35-5-108(1) , CRS, of the presence of noxious weeds, specifically MUSK THISTLE (Carduus nutans) and CANADA THISTLE (Cirsium arvense) on a parcel of land which is owned, leased, and/or occupied by you, and is described as follows: Legal - T7N R67W SEC 13 W2 Parcel 070513000025 This land is in the WINDSOR - SEVERANCE Pest Control Districts. When musk thistle is in the rosette stage it is easiest to control. The best method of control or eradication is to use herbicides that are labeled for the specific weed and site , or by mechanical means , such as mowing two to three times during the summer. The plants must be kept from going to seed. If you need help with herbicide rates , please feel free to call me at 356-4000, Ext. 4470. Pursuant to Section 35-5-108(1) , CRS , you are required to use one of these methods to control or eradicate these weeds. If you do not comply with the aforementioned required by May 27, 1991, or call me about establishing a mechanical control program, I will ask the Weld County Board of County Commissioners to approve my entry upon such parcel to control or eradicate such noxious weeds, pursuant to Section 35-5-108(2) , CRS, at your expense, as provided in Section 35-5-108(3) , CRS.
